package kotlin.jdk8.streams.test
import kotlin.streams.*
import org.junit.Test
import java.util.stream.*
import kotlin.test.*
class StreamsTest {
@Test fun toList() {
val data = arrayOf(1, 2L, 1.23, null)
val streamBuilder = { Stream.of(*data) }
assertEquals(data.asList(), streamBuilder().toList())
assertEquals(listOf(1), streamBuilder().filter { it is Int }.mapToInt { it as Int }.toList())
assertEquals(listOf(2L), streamBuilder().filter { it is Long }.mapToLong { it as Long }.toList())
assertEquals(listOf(1.23), streamBuilder().filter { it is Double }.mapToDouble { it as Double }.toList())
}
@Test fun asSequence() {
val data = arrayOf(1, 2L, 1.23, null)
fun<T> assertSequenceContent(expected: List<T>, actual: Sequence<T>) {
assertEquals(expected, actual.toList())
assertFailsWith<IllegalStateException>("Second iteration fails") { actual.toList() }
}
assertSequenceContent(data.asList(), Stream.of(*data).asSequence())
assertSequenceContent(listOf(1, 2), IntStream.of(1, 2).asSequence())
assertSequenceContent(listOf(1L, 2L), LongStream.of(1L, 2L).asSequence())
assertSequenceContent(listOf(1.0, 2.0), DoubleStream.of(1.0, 2.0).asSequence())
}
@Test fun asStream() {
val sequence = generateSequence(0) { it -> it * it + 1 }
val stream = sequence.asStream()
val expected = Stream.iterate(0) { it -> it * it + 1 }
assertEquals(expected.limit(7).toList(), stream.limit(7).toList())
}
@Test fun asParallelStream() {
val sequence = generateSequence(0) { it + 2 } // even numbers
val stream = sequence.asStream().parallel().map { it / 2 }
val n = 100000
val expected = (0 until n).toList()
assertEquals(expected, stream.limit(n.toLong()).toList())
}
}
